Probably not: Your breasts are sensitive to hormone changes which start with ovulation (about 2 weeks before your period) and persist until your next period. Of course if you do conceive this will continue, but that is what home pregnancy tests are for. Cramping can occur with ovulation and then again prior to your period and is also not specific for pregnancy.
